About Us Sigma is the only cloud analytics and business intelligence tool empowering business teams to break free from the confines of the dashboard, explore data for themselves, and make better, faster decisions. The award‑winning software was built to capitalize on the performance power of cloud data warehouses to combine data sources and analyze billions of rows of data instantly via an intuitive, spreadsheet‑like interface – no coding required. Since launching with its unique interface, Sigma Computing has added features such as collaboration tools and embedded analytics capabilities. The most recent product launch included a set of AI tools such as forecasting capabilities, an AI copilot, and a notebook interface for users who prefer a code‑first environment. Sigma announced $200M in Series D financing in May 2024 to continue transforming BI through its innovations in AI infrastructure, data application development, enterprise‑wide collaboration, and business user adoption. Spark Capital and Avenir Growth Capital co‑led the Series D funding round, with additional participation from a group of past investors including Snowflake Ventures and Sutter Hill Ventures. The Series D funding, raised at a valuation 60 % higher than the company’s Series C round three years ago, promises to further accelerate Sigma’s growth.
